High variability in the reproducibility of key hemodynamic responses to head-up tilt.

Abstract

Increased blood pressure upon standing is considered a cardiovascular risk factor. We investigated the reproducibility of changes in aortic blood pressure, heart rate, stroke volume, cardiac output, and systemic vascular resistance during three passive head-up tilts (HUT) in 223 participants without cardiovascular medications (mean age 46 yr, BMI 28 kg/m, 54% male). The median time gap between the first and the second HUT was 9 wk and the second and the third HUT was 4 wk. We utilized whole body impedance cardiography and radial artery tonometry as methods. The participants were divided into quartiles of the changes in each hemodynamic variable during the first HUT, and the reproducibility of these changes was tested during successive HUTs. During the first HUT, significant differences were present in all between-quartile comparisons ( = 6) of all variables. The differences persisted as follows: reduction of stroke volume in six out of six (6/6) between-quartile comparisons ( < 0.001), decrease in cardiac output ( < 0.001) and increase in heart rate in 5/6 comparisons ( < 0.001), change in systemic vascular resistance in 3/6 comparisons ( < 0.001), change in aortic systolic blood pressure in 1/6 comparisons ( = 0.043), and change in aortic diastolic blood pressure in none ( = 0.266). To conclude, the reproducibility of upright posture-induced changes is high for stroke volume, cardiac output, and heart rate, moderate for systemic vascular resistance, and modest for aortic blood pressure. Although an increase in blood pressure during upright posture may be a cardiovascular risk factor, this effect may be attributed to other underlying hemodynamic variables that exhibit more reproducible posture-related changes. We examined the reproducibility of hemodynamic responses to three passive head-up tilts. The associated changes in stroke volume, cardiac output, and heart rate were highly reproducible. Systemic vascular resistance showed moderate reproducibility, whereas blood pressure changes during upright posture were modestly reproducible. If an exaggerated blood pressure response to upright posture is a cardiovascular risk factor, it is likely attributed to other hemodynamic variables that exhibit more reproducible posture-related changes.

摘要

站立时血压升高被认为是一种心血管危险因素。我们在223名未服用心血管药物的参与者(平均年龄46岁,体重指数28kg/m²,54%为男性)中,研究了三次被动头高位倾斜(HUT)期间主动脉血压、心率、每搏量、心输出量和全身血管阻力变化的可重复性。第一次和第二次HUT之间的中位时间间隔为9周,第二次和第三次HUT之间为4周。我们采用全身阻抗心动图和桡动脉压测量法。根据第一次HUT期间每个血流动力学变量的变化将参与者分为四分位数,并在连续的HUT期间测试这些变化的可重复性。在第一次HUT期间,所有变量的所有四分位数间比较(n = 6)均存在显著差异。差异持续如下:每搏量在6/6次四分位数间比较中降低(P < 0.001),心输出量降低(P < 0.001),心率在5/6次比较中升高(P < 0.001),全身血管阻力在3/6次比较中变化(P < 0.001),主动脉收缩压在1/6次比较中变化(P = 0.043),主动脉舒张压无变化(P = 0.266)。总之,直立姿势引起的每搏量、心输出量和心率变化的可重复性高,全身血管阻力的可重复性中等,主动脉血压的可重复性一般。虽然直立姿势期间血压升高可能是一种心血管危险因素,但这种效应可能归因于其他潜在的血流动力学变量,这些变量表现出与姿势相关的更具可重复性的变化。我们研究了对三次被动头高位倾斜的血流动力学反应的可重复性。每搏量、心输出量和心率的相关变化具有高度可重复性。全身血管阻力显示出中等可重复性,而直立姿势期间的血压变化具有一般可重复性。如果对直立姿势的血压反应过度是一种心血管危险因素,那么很可能归因于其他表现出与姿势相关的更具可重复性变化的血流动力学变量。
